Set just off the main paved road that winds into Torio, the property enjoys direct and effortless access—a rare advantage in this coastal region. From the gate, it's a quick two-minute drive into the center of Torio, where you’ll find a small but steadily growing town that blends local charm with expat-friendly conveniences. The beach is only three minutes away, making it easy to dip into the ocean, go for a sunset walk, or explore the coastline before breakfast.
The surrounding area is known for its variety of beaches, each offering something a little different. In just six minutes you can be in Malena, a mellow spot ideal for swimming and relaxing. Morillo Beach, a renowned destination for surfers, is about 15 minutes away and draws both seasoned riders and beginners. Playa Reina, another favorite for beachgoers and fishing enthusiasts, is roughly 25 minutes up the coast.
For errands and essentials, the larger district hub of Mariato is only a 15-minute drive. There, you’ll find a bank, grocery stores, hardware shops, a health clinic, pharmacies, and other everyday services. If you’re looking for broader shopping options, international stores, or a big city day trip, Santiago—the closest major city—is just an hour away. It offers a large shopping mall, PriceSmart (Panama’s version of Costco), and a wide array of retail chains and restaurants.
Dining out locally is easy as well. Within 3 to 5 minutes of the property are several casual and international restaurants, where you’ll find everything from Tex-Mex to Italian and Panamanian cuisine.

Torio is a small but growing beach town on Panama’s Azuero Peninsula. It’s best known for its relaxed lifestyle, surf-friendly coastline, and proximity to nature. The area has drawn a steady community of expats, many of whom value the region for its mix of mountains, rivers, and sea—all within minutes of each other. Torio is also one of the last places on the Pacific side of Panama where you can find large, usable parcels with true ocean views at a relatively accessible price point.
The town itself has a few essential services including restaurants, grocery options, and a gas station, with more amenities available nearby in Mariato and Santiago. It’s a practical yet peaceful place to live, with new businesses and homes appearing each year.
